Trust by Kylie Scott



Being young is all about the experiences: the first time you skip school, the first time you fall in love…the first time someone holds a gun to your head.

After being held hostage during a robbery at the local convenience store, seventeen year old Edie finds her attitude about life shattered. Unwilling to put up with the snobbery and bullying at her private school, she enrolls at the local public high school, crossing paths with John. The boy who risked his life to save hers.

While Edie’s beginning to run wild, however, John’s just starting to settle down. After years of partying and dealing drugs with his older brother, he’s going straight—getting to class on time, and thinking about the future.

An unlikely bond grows between the two as John keeps Edie out of trouble and helps her broaden her horizons. But when he helps her out with another first—losing her virginity—their friendship gets complicated.

Meanwhile, Edie and John are pulled back into the dangerous world they narrowly escaped. They were lucky to survive the first time, but this time they have more to lose—each other.

Kylie can definitely write high-school angst, teenage feelings, and lust. She'll make you contemplate life, death, and the what ifs through the eyes of a traumatized teenager. 
Though, in true Kylie fashion, all this is done while making you laugh! Her characters are sarcastic, witty, and hilarious.
My husband asked if I was enjoying my book, because the entire time he watched me I'd had a smile on my face while reading!!
